What Exactly is 'Seedesine' in Web Design?


At its core, seedesine refers to the intentional layering of design elements to create a seamless, organic flow throughout a website. It’s about planting the seeds of visual and functional harmony early in the design process and nurturing them into a cohesive user experience. Think of it as the DNA of your website’s design—subtle, yet powerful.


For example, when I design a website, I don’t just slap together colors, fonts, and images. I carefully consider how each element interacts with the others. The spacing, the typography hierarchy, the way images lead the eye—all of these are part of seedesine. It’s a strategic approach that ensures every part of the site feels connected and purposeful.

How Seedesine Shapes Branding and User Experience


Branding is more than just a logo or color palette. It’s the emotional and visual story your website tells. Seedesine plays a critical role here by ensuring that every design choice supports your brand’s identity and values.


When I work on branding through web design, I focus on how seedesine can reinforce your message. For instance, if your brand is about trust and professionalism, the design elements will be layered to evoke calmness and reliability. This might mean using a consistent grid system, balanced white space, and a restrained color scheme that guides users effortlessly through your content.


On the flip side, if your brand is bold and innovative, seedesine helps me integrate dynamic visuals and interactive elements that feel fresh but still cohesive. The key is that nothing feels out of place or accidental. Every detail is part of a bigger picture.

Practical Tips for Implementing Seedesine in Your Website


If you’re ready to invest in a custom website, here are some actionable recommendations to ensure seedesine is part of your project:


  1. Start with a clear strategy - Define your brand’s core message and how you want users to feel when they visit your site. This foundation guides all design decisions.

  2. Focus on consistency - Use a limited color palette, consistent typography, and uniform spacing. This creates a visual rhythm that feels natural.

  3. Prioritize user flow - Design your site so that visitors can navigate intuitively. Use visual cues like arrows, buttons, and whitespace to guide them.

  4. Layer design elements thoughtfully - Think about how backgrounds, images, text, and interactive features work together. Avoid clutter and aim for harmony.

  5. Test and refine - A website is never truly finished. Use analytics and user feedback to tweak the design and improve the experience continuously.
